Granny, if you have no luggage to claim, head directly to the Welcome Center and they will check your name off the list and place you on a bus.
Just rec'd this from Disney Rep:
Nanc, we will have the DME representative in the Main Terminal, so many in Navy uniforms with white Mickey hands that it will be hard to miss them. They will be escorting them down to the Welcome Center, taking all baggage claim information, getting their bags from baggage claim and getting them on the buses with their bags and off to the resort. Just an FYI. The re-printing is for arrivals May 5-24, with the hopes all is smooth by the 24, and the system works correctly, with these vouchers arriving 21 days out.

If this will ease the worry for some...
My HS sent 280+ kids and chaperones to WDW for a music event last week, and were a test case for the ME. They were met by the aforementioned reps on navy blazers with Mickey hands, and walked straight onto busses. All were told by trip leaders to quickly dump their carry-ons in their rooms and head to the MK.
Upon arriving back at the All-Star Music later that night, they discovered exactly TWO missing bags out of 500+ that were transfered (kids had a suitcase and a garment bag with their band uniform). Both bags had been placed in the wrong room, and were quickly re-located.
Their luggage tags arrived in bulk about a week before departure, and they also had a small yellow ribbon to attach to each bag. A little trickier on the way home as most or all could not check bags at the hotel, but the kids and adults I spoke to were very happy with the service.
